Which original members of Chicago have left the band?

Executive summary

Chicago was formed in February 1967 with seven core founding members: Terry Kath, Robert Lamm, Danny Seraphine, Walter Parazaider, Lee Loughnane, James Pankow and (added in December 1967) Peter Cetera; as of recent reporting three of those originals — Lamm, Pankow and Loughnane — remain active [1] [2]. Over the band’s six-decade run several original members have left — by death, dismissal, or solo careers — including Terry Kath (died 1978), Peter Cetera (left 1985), and Danny Seraphine (departed later); current sources list three originals still touring with the group [2] [3] [4].

1. The original seven — who they were and when they formed

Chicago began as The Big Thing in February 1967; the original lineup consisted of Terry Kath (guitar/vocals), Robert Lamm (keyboards/vocals), Danny Seraphine (drums), Walter Parazaider (saxophone), Lee Loughnane (trumpet) and James Pankow (trombone), with Peter Cetera added on bass in December 1967 before the band shortened its name to Chicago [1] [4]. This is the roster most histories treat as “the original members” because Cetera joined in the band’s first year and features on the classic early albums [1].

2. Who among those originals have left — deaths and departures

Terry Kath, a founding guitarist and vocalist, died accidentally in 1978; that event effectively removed an original member and precipitated lineup changes [5]. Peter Cetera, the bassist and a major lead vocalist in the 1970s and early ’80s, left the band in 1985 to pursue a solo career [6]. Danny Seraphine, the band’s founding drummer, is also a former member — sources list him among those who no longer play with Chicago, though recent coverage emphasizes the three originals still performing are Lamm, Pankow and Loughnane [2] [3] [4]. 3. Who remains from the founding era — “the three originals”

Multiple recent accounts identify three original members still active with Chicago: Robert Lamm, James Pankow and Lee Loughnane [2] [3]. Ultimate Classic Rock reported that as of early 2025 those three were the remaining originals as the band approached its 60th anniversary [2]. CultureSonar likewise names Lamm, Pankow and Loughnane as the surviving, active founders in its 2024 profile [3].

4. Other notable departures and personnel turnover

Beyond the seven “originals,” Chicago has seen many members, additions, touring substitutes and studio contributors leave over decades: percussionist Laudir de Oliveira and multi‑instrumentalist Marty Grebb departed after contributing in the 1970s and early ’80s [7] [6]; guitarists and sidemen such as Donnie Dacus (replaced Kath briefly) and later Chris Pinnick, Dawayne Bailey and others cycled through [5] [8]. More recent departures include longtime drummer Tris Imboden (announced leaving in January 2018) and bassist/vocalist Jeff Coffey (January 2018); Chicago replaced and rotated members regularly during touring [7] [9].

6. Bottom line for the question “Which original members have left the band?”

From the set usually called the original members (Kath, Lamm, Seraphine, Parazaider, Loughnane, Pankow, Cetera): Terry Kath is deceased (died 1978), Peter Cetera left in 1985 to go solo, and Danny Seraphine is no longer in the band; several other early contributors and near‑originals (for example Laudir de Oliveira, Marty Grebb) also departed over time [5] [6] [4]. Current reporting emphasizes that Robert Lamm, James Pankow and Lee Loughnane remain active with Chicago [2] [3].
